EMV L2 testing evaluates the 'EMV Level 2 kernel', which is the software inside the terminal (known as firmware) that performs EMV processing, for compliance with the EMV Chip Specifications. Visa leverages EMVCo's product testing and approval process for contact-only devices, these devices are required to obtain EMVCo approval for Level 1 (interface module) and Level 2 (application) and do not need to be submitted to Approval Services. EMV Level 2 covers the set of functions that provide all the necessary processing logic and data that is required to select and process a card application in order to perform an EMV transaction. There is an extensive EMVCo defned Level 2 approval process which requires every EMV Kernel to have completed laboratory type approval testing before it can be used in terminals to perform EMV transactions.
